The creators of Mart Bingo prove once again that a sense of humor can make up for a lack of 3D graphics (but is probably cheaper to make).  I won’t ruin the punchline of the joke, but given to the right person this app could potentially last years.

The app is pretty simple.  Using the "finger-flick" motion, you uncrumble the card and read the message inside.  That’s it.  Supposedly, there is an Easter Egg as well, but damned if I can find it.

While I appreciate the creators’ efforts on this one, I have to say that it was a bit of a disappointment compared to Mart Bingo.  I recognize that sequels are rarely as good as the original but I had high hopes.  Perhaps their next application can be the one involving the shape-shifting alien currently taking the form of an iPod Touch and having sex with your fingers which you know you’re enjoying because you’re smiling at that very moment.

If this application were a movie, it would be Weekend at Bernie’s II.  Okay on it’s own, but nowhere near as good as the original.

Left to my own devices, I likely would not have purchased this app even at its current low price of $.99.  I would simply go back and buy a second copy of Mart Bingo in case I lost the first one.

But, perhaps I’m not the best person to ask about this application, since according to its analysis, I’m an idiot.

Pros: Cute idea.  Interesting presentation.

Cons: Not interesting enough to buy.  Some folks might not get the joke.
